1. Prayer for Renewed Vision and Purpose

Lord, I come before You today feeling a profound sense of stagnation, as if my vision has been clouded and my purpose obscured. The path ahead seems unclear, and the drive that once propelled me forward has waned. I confess that I have tried to navigate this season in my own strength, but I find myself weary and lost. I pray that You would grant me a fresh vision for my life, revealing Your divine plan and purpose for me. Help me to see with spiritual eyes, to understand Your will, and to be re-ignited with a passion for the calling You have placed on my heart.

“For the vision is yet for an appointed time, but at the end it shall speak, and not lie: though it tarry, wait for it; because it will surely come, it will not tarry.” – Habakkuk 2:3

My soul waits for the Lord more than watchmen wait for the morning, more than watchmen wait for the morning. – Psalm 130:6

Father, I ask for clarity and direction. Remove any hindrances or distractions that are preventing me from seeing Your path clearly. Instill in me a renewed sense of purpose, reminding me of the unique gifts and talents You have bestowed upon me. Help me to trust Your timing and to have patience as You unfold Your plans. Grant me the courage to take the next step, even if I cannot see the entire staircase. I surrender my confusion and my weariness to You, trusting that You will guide me with wisdom and love.

2. Prayer for Breakthrough and Release

Heavenly Father, I am trapped in a cycle of stagnation, and I desperately need Your breakthrough. It feels as though invisible walls surround me, preventing progress in my personal life, my career, and my spiritual walk. I acknowledge that I cannot break these chains on my own. I cry out to You for Your mighty intervention, for Your power to shatter these barriers and release me into the freedom You have promised. Open doors that are closed, and close doors that are leading me astray.

“Now the God of peace, that brought again from the dead our Lord Jesus, that great shepherd of the sheep, through the blood of the everlasting covenant, make you perfect in every good work to do his will, working in you that which is pleasing in his sight, through Jesus Christ; to whom be glory for ever and ever. Amen.” – Hebrews 13:20-21

The Lord shall fight for you, and ye shall hold your peace. – Exodus 14:14

Lord, I ask You to dismantle every obstacle that stands in my way. Remove the limitations I have placed on myself and the limitations others may have placed upon me. Grant me the strength and resilience to persevere through this season, knowing that You are with me. I release my anxieties and fears into Your hands, trusting that You are working all things for my good. Empower me to step out of this stagnant place and into the abundant life You have planned.

4. Prayer for Strength to Overcome Inertia

Almighty God, the inertia of stagnation is heavy upon me. It feels like a physical weight, making it difficult to even begin the tasks that lie before me. I lack the motivation and the energy to move forward, and I am frustrated by my own inactivity. I turn to You, the source of all strength, and ask for Your power to infuse my being. Give me the physical, mental, and spiritual strength needed to overcome this resistance and to take decisive action.

“I can do all things through Christ which strengtheneth me.” – Philippians 4:13

The righteous cry, and the Lord heareth, and delivereth them out of all their troubles. – Psalm 34:17

Lord, I pray for a surge of divine energy. Remove any spiritual or emotional blocks that are contributing to this inertia. Renew my mind with Your truth and Your promises, so that I may approach my responsibilities with renewed vigor. Help me to take one step at a time, trusting that each step forward is progress. I release my feelings of helplessness and ask You to empower me to move forward with confidence and determination.

11. Prayer for Overcoming Fear and Doubt

Dear Father, fear and doubt have become companions in this season of stagnation, paralyzing my will and clouding my judgment. I feel unable to move forward because of the anxieties that grip my heart. I turn to You, the God of courage and peace, and ask for Your strength to conquer these debilitating emotions. Replace my fear with faith and my doubt with unwavering trust in Your promises.

“For God hath not given us the spirit of fear; but of power, and of love, and of a sound mind.” – 2 Timothy 1:7

The Lord is my light and my salvation; whom shall I fear? the Lord is the strength of my life; of whom shall I be afraid? – Psalm 27:1

Lord, I pray for Your peace that surpasses all understanding to guard my heart and my mind. Cast out every spirit of fear and doubt that seeks to hold me captive. Empower me to face challenges with boldness, knowing that You are with me and You will guide me. Help me to stand firm on Your Word, which is a lamp unto my feet and a light unto my path.
